js正则表达式验证数字1到5,js正则表达式两个字符之间三位数字
其实js正则表达式验证数字1到5的问题并不复杂,但是又很多的朋友都不太了解js正则表达式两个字符之间三位数字,因此呢,今天小编就来为大家分享js正则表达式验证数字1到5的一些知识,希望可以帮助到大家,下面我们一起来看看这个问题的分析吧!
一、js用正则表达式把数字格式化成XXXX-XXX-XXX的形式
'xxxxx'.match(/\d{x,y}/g) 如 '111,1111,11111'.match(/\d{4,10}/g) =>['1111','11111']
二、js正则表达式两个字符之间三位数字
正则表达式如下:^[1-9]\d{0,2}$↑↑↑后面的数字可以有0-2位第一位不能为0^代表开始$代表结束
三、js怎么让input只能输入数字
要让input只能输入数字,你可以采取以下步骤:
1.监听input的键盘事件:使用addeventlistener方法来监听input的键盘事件,常用的事件是"keydown"和"keyup"。
2.检查输入值是否为数字:在键盘事件的回调函数中,获取输入的值,并使用isnan()函数检查其是否为数字。isnan()函数返回true表示不是数字,返回false表示是数字。
3.阻止非数字输入:如果输入值不是数字,你可以使用event.preventdefault()方法来阻止默认的输入行为,从而保证只有数字能够被输入。
总结:通过监听input的键盘事件,检查输入值是否为数字,并阻止非数字的输入,你可以实现让input只能输入数字的效果。记得在合适的时机移除事件监听,以免造成性能问题。
关于js正则表达式验证数字1到5到此分享完毕,希望能帮助到您。
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- js正则表达式验证数字不重复?js字符串校验,正则表达式 2023-11-29
- js正则表达式验证数字1到5,js正则表达式两个字符之间三位数字 2023-11-29
- js正则表达式验证数字 字母 汉字?js正则表达式两个字符之间三位数字 2023-11-29
- js正则表达式验证手机号码格式(js字符串校验,正则表达式) 2023-11-29
- js正则表达式验证手机号码提交?什么是密码验证码 2023-11-29
- js正则表达式验证手机号码分析(怎么用手机号匹配数据) 2023-11-29